Structure of the Driving License Exam
The driving license exam generally includes 2 main components: the composed test and the useful driving test.
1. Composed Test
The written component assesses a candidate's understanding of roadway rules, traffic signs, and safe driving practices. It often involves multiple-choice concerns and true/false concerns, covering subjects such as:
- Road signs and their significances
- Traffic laws and regulations
- Safe driving methods
- Treatments for dealing with emergencies
- Rights and responsibilities of drivers
Prospects are generally required to study the local motorist's handbook, which describes the appropriate laws and guidelines for safe driving.
2. Practical Driving Test
Following a successful composed examination, candidates must finish a practical driving test. This hands-on evaluation measures a prospect's capability to run a lorry and follow traffic guidelines in real-world conditions. Key elements of the practical test consist of:
- Vehicle control and dealing with
- Obeying traffic signals and signs
- Browsing crossways and turns
- Appropriate use of mirrors and signal lights
- Parking techniques (parallel, perpendicular, etc)
- Responding to pedestrian and cyclist presence
Both components are essential for obtaining a driving license, and sufficient preparation is necessary for success.
Requirements to Take the Driving License Exam
Requirements for taking the driving license test differ by jurisdiction, however there are common requirements that the majority of candidates should meet:
- Age Requirement: Most jurisdictions need candidates to be a minimum of 16 years of ages, although some might allow earlier testing with adult permission.
- Learner's Permit: Many regions need prospects to get a learner's authorization before taking the driving exam. This license enables individuals to practice driving under adult guidance.
- Documentation: Candidates should offer valid recognition, evidence of residency, and, in some cases, paperwork of completed driver education courses.
- Practice Hours: Some jurisdictions mandate a minimum variety of practice hours behind the wheel before being eligible for the driving test.
Preparing for the Driving License Exam
Preparation is key to passing the driving license examination. Here are numerous strategies prospects can employ:
1. Research study the Driver's Manual
- Comprehensive Review: Candidates ought to study their local motorist's handbook vigilantly given that it contains vital info needed for the composed test.
- Practice Tests: Numerous online resources provide practice tests that mimic the composed assessment format. Completing these can help improve confidence and knowledge retention.
2. Practice Driving Skills
- On-the-Road Practice: Driving under the guidance of an experienced certified driver is important. Prospects need to practice different driving maneuvers, consisting of parking, lane modifications, and emergency stops.
- Mock Driving Tests: Conducting mock driving tests can be beneficial. Relative or good friends can evaluate the prospect's efficiency and supply feedback.
3. Take a Driver Education Course
- Professional Instruction: Many prospects decide to enroll in chauffeur education courses led by qualified instructors. These courses offer important insights into traffic laws and safe driving practices, and typically include both class and behind-the-wheel training.
- Understanding Vehicle Mechanics: Familiarization with car controls, maintenance, and safety features can enhance confidence throughout the practical test.

Q: How do I know if I passed my driving test?
A: After completing the practical driving test, the inspector will typically provide instant feedback. If you pass, you will receive details on how to obtain your driver's license. If you stop working, the inspector will use insights on areas needing enhancement and how to retest.

Q: How often can I retake the driving test if I fail?
A: The retake policy differs by region. Some areas may enable prospects to retake the examination as soon as the following day, while others might impose a waiting duration of numerous weeks. It is necessary to talk to the local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or comparable authority for specific policies.
Q: Can I take the driving test in a various lorry than the one utilized for practice?
A: Yes, prospects can take the test in a various car; nevertheless, the lorry needs to fulfill safety and operational standards. It is suggested to familiarize oneself with the different controls of the new lorry prior to the exam.
Q: Are there accommodations for people with impairments throughout the driving test?
A: Most jurisdictions offer accommodations for people with disabilities. It is advised to contact the local DMV or equivalent authority beforehand to discuss specific needs and available accommodations.
